What is a Maximo Data Analyst?

A Maximo Data Analyst is a professional who specializes in managing, analyzing, and interpreting data within IBM Maximo, an enterprise asset management (EAM) software. They are responsible for ensuring data accuracy, consistency, and integrity in Maximo, as well as generating reports and insights to support decision-making. Their tasks often include data migration, cleansing, and the creation of dashboards and KPIs. Maximo Data Analysts work closely with IT, maintenance, and business teams to optimize asset management processes. Their expertise helps organizations maximize the value of their physical assets and improve operational efficiency.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Maximo Data Analyst?

To thrive as a Maximo Data Analyst, you need strong analytical skills, experience with asset management data, and a solid understanding of IBM Maximo, often supported by a relevant degree in information systems or engineering. Proficiency in Maximo modules, SQL, data visualization tools, and familiarity with reporting systems like BIRT or Cognos is typically required. Attention to detail,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ication are essential soft skills to excel in this role. These skills are crucial for accurately analyzing and optimizing asset data, supporting operational decisions, and ensuring data-driven improvements in enterprise asset management.

What are some typical challenges a Maximo Data Analyst faces when integrating data from multiple sources?

A Maximo Data Analyst often encounters challenges such as data inconsistency, varying data formats, and incomplete information when integrating data from multiple sources. Ensuring data quality and accuracy is critical, as errors can affect asset management and reporting. Collaborating closely with IT teams, end users, and other analysts is essential to map data correctly, validate inputs, and streamline integration processes. Staying up-to-date with Maximo's data structures and industry best practices also helps in overcoming these challenges efficiently.
